How the work is built
MindView therapy has a stated structure, and we keep to it. Your first session is an intake ending in 0-to-10 symptom ratings - a real baseline, written down. The work then broadens to the rest of your life, with nothing you are obliged to answer, and produces a written treatment plan you co-author, goals phrased your way, one of them yours alone. Weekly sessions follow, and once a month the standardized measures come back out and the trend gets an honest look. Flat trend means the plan changes. You will never be six months in wondering what this is accomplishing; the answer will be on the chart.
The approach is matched to what you bring, anchored in cognitive behavioral therapy - practical, present-focused, skills-first. Your therapist is licensed in Indiana.

The first three sessions follow a clear structure, so you always know what is coming next.
- The first meeting
Your first session is an intake. Your therapist asks what brought you in and about your history, and you rate the intensity of what you are feeling from 0 to 10. That becomes your baseline. You set a recurring weekly time before you leave.
- The wider picture
Your therapist walks through your life across stages, looking for the patterns and strengths behind what brought you in. You can decline any question and keep any answer short.
- Building the plan
You and your therapist build the plan together. Goals are tied to what you came in for, each with concrete objectives, plus one personal goal that matters to you.
- Ongoing
Weekly sessions work the plan. Once a month you and your therapist review standardized measures together to see whether it is working, and the plan is adjusted from what they show.
Therapy here is measured, not guessed
Once a month you have a measurement-based care review. You complete standardized measures, and your therapist reviews the trend with you. If something is not working, the plan changes. Regular therapy is the work. The review is the navigation system that keeps it pointed at the right target.
Sessions are weekly for the first two months to build a foundation, then frequency is reassessed with you. You set the pace, and you share only what you are comfortable sharing.
